Anti-Mouse EXOC4 Immunohistochemistry Kit (CAT#: VS-0525-XY2385)
This EXOC4 IHC kit provides optimized reagents for detecting exocyst subunits important in membrane fusion and vesicle transport. Compatible with paraffin and frozen sections, it ensures consistent results for studies on cellular transport mechanisms, secretion, and tissue organization across species.
